Living with an invisible illness: a qualitative study exploring the lived experiences of female children with congenital adrenal hyperplasia
ConclusionExploring children ’s views about living with an invisible illness illuminated individual aspects contributing to our in-depth understanding of experiences of children with CAH. Ongoing education and awareness of CAH is necessary to help mitigate the stigma associated with living with CAH.
